Checklist – Got Everything?

This list shall help you to, if possible, pack all necessary papers and documents:

Tickets
 Plane-, train- and/or bus tickets

Certificates
 Certificate of Birth
 Passport, which is valid for the whole period of study (prolongation is only possible in your home country!)
 Visa (if necessary; refer to page Visa)
 Vaccination Card (did you get all necessary vaccinations?)
 Emergency Cards (blood type, allergies ...) (if existent)
 International driving licence or German translation of the driving licence (if existent). More information can be found at the Bundesverkehrsministerium (German Federal Ministry of Transport): Gültigkeit ausländischer Fahrerlaubnisse.
 International Student Identity Card (ISIC) (if existent)
 Youth Hostel Card (if existent)
 Several passport-sized photographs

Documents
 Certificates of Secondary School (university admission entitlement) and – if existent – of the university with certified translation. You can get official certifications e.g. at the German missions abroad in your home country.
 Proof of language abilities (refer to page Admission and Language Abilities)
 Admission Notice or Application Confirmation of the German University 
 Proof of Financial Resources (refer to page Proof of Financial Resources)
 Confirmation of the legal or private health insurance (refer to page Health Insurance)

Money and Bank Cards
 Cash (Euro)
Exchange sufficient foreign currency for the first few days. You will need enough money to pay public transport, food, maybe temporary accommodation in a hotel or a youth hostel and first purchases for your room or your apartment.
 Credit Card (if existent, don’t forget the according telephone number to stop the card in case of theft etc.)

Other
 Essential Medication
 Address Book
